Subject: DR drill next Thursday — Graphlet viz

Hi! Quick heads-up: we're running the disaster-recovery drill for Graphlet, our dependency graph visualizer, on Thursday morning. Your part is simple — restore the render cache from the Fenwick Bay snapshot and confirm the graph loads. Nothing scary, I'll be on the call. To unseal the snapshot archive, use the recovery phrase below.

recovery phrase for yajeg-tagep: rusok-briwyn-belvan-kelax-novmir-fenath-eliael-fraok-holok

Ticket #-- Connection failures after font vendoring

Since we vendored the Tallowtype font set into the Mirebrook build, the asset pipeline opens extra sockets during packaging and the pool to the metadata database is exhausting, causing intermittent connection failures. No credentials were moved; the fonts themselves are license-reviewed. Requesting security sign-off on the vendored files and the pool change. To reproduce the failure against staging, use the connection string below.

replica DSN, yahaf-yagaf: mongodb://tamath_svc:a2netSk3RZMuTj@db-d084.novacsoft.internal:5432/ralmir

The Farelab ticket-pricing experiment service rejected last night's config push with a signature mismatch, so the new fare variants never went live and all venues fell back to baseline pricing. Root cause: the config was signed with the retired staging key after last week's rotation. No customer-facing pricing errors occurred. Support should tell experimenters to re-sign configs with the current key and resubmit; pushes verified against it deploy normally. The active verification key is below.

release key, bahof-hafog: bky3_ztf

Handover note for plugin authors taking over the Tumblewash laundry-locker access flow. The locker grant sequence is: reservation check, door-controller handshake, then a short-lived access token minted by the Pinrow service. Plugins must never cache that token; the controller rejects reuse after ninety seconds. I've left detailed sequence diagrams and failure-mode notes in the shared design folder, plus a stub simulator for the door hardware. To open the simulator's credential store on first run, supply the recovery passphrase given below.

unlock words, bahop-fawef: novmir-druwyn-soriel-rusdor-kasion